What in the world is CTE anyway? CTE stands for Career and Technical Education. Career and Technical Education (CTE) provides students with the academic and technical skills, knowledge and training necessary to succeed in future careers and develop skills they will use throughout their careers. CTE prepares students for the world of work by introducing them to workplace competencies, and makes academic content accessible to students by providing it in a hands-on context. CTE is a great way for students to explore a variety of career options early and earn industry certifications prior to graduation.
